Mainland vs Free Zone vs Offshore — Which is Right for You?


One of the most important decisions in setting up a business is choosing the right jurisdiction.

1. Dubai Mainland Company Setup


A Dubai mainland company gives you maximum operational freedom.

Best For:
Businesses that want to trade within Dubai, across the UAE, or internationally.

Benefits:

  • 100% foreign ownership allowed


  • No limit on visas (based on office space)


  • Freedom to work with government projects


  • Ability to open offices anywhere in Dubai/UAE



Ideal For:
Retail shops, restaurants, consultancy firms, contracting companies, logistics, and more.

2. Dubai Free Zone Company Setup


Dubai offers 40+ free zones, each specialized in industries like media, technology, finance, logistics, healthcare, and more.

Best For:
Entrepreneurs who want complete ownership and low-cost licensing options.

Benefits:

  • 100% ownership


  • 100% repatriation of profits


  • Zero corporate tax in many sectors


  • Quick and hassle-free licensing


  • No import/export duties



Popular Free Zones:

  • IFZA Dubai


  • Dubai Multi Commodities Centre (DMCC)


  • Meydan Free Zone


  • Dubai Airport Free Zone (DAFZA)


  • Dubai Silicon Oasis (DSO)



3. Offshore Company Setup in Dubai


An offshore company is ideal for holding assets, tax planning, and international business operations without local trade.

Benefits:

  • 100% foreign ownership


  • No audit requirements


  • 100% tax-free operations


  • International banking facilities



Common Offshore Jurisdictions:
JAFZA Offshore, RAK ICC

Step-by-Step: How to Set Up a Business in Dubai


Setting up a business in Dubai involves a clear and organized process. Here’s what every investor needs to know:

Step 1: Choose Your Business Activity


Dubai allows over 2,500+ activities—commercial, industrial, professional, and tourism sectors. Choosing the right activity ensures licensing accuracy and avoids compliance issues later.

Step 2: Select the Company Structure


Your company structure determines legal obligations, ownership, and operational freedom.

Most common structures include:

  • Sole Establishment


  • Limited Liability Company (LLC)


  • Free Zone FZE / FZCO


  • Branch Office



Step 3: Reserve Your Trade Name


Your company name must follow UAE guidelines. It should be:

  • Unique


  • Free from blasphemy or political references


  • Reflective of your business activity



Step 4: Get Initial Approval


This confirms the government has no objection to your company formation. It’s a mandatory step before documents are processed.

Step 5: Prepare Legal Documents


This includes:

  • copyright copies


  • Emirates ID (if applicable)


  • Proof of address


  • Business plan (for some free zones)


  • Memorandum of Association (MOA)



Step 6: Choose Your Office Space


You can choose:

  • Flexi desk


  • Shared office


  • Private office


  • Virtual office (in many free zones)



The size of your office influences your visa quota.

Step 7: Apply for Your Business License


Once your documents and approvals are submitted, the authority issues your business license.

Types of licenses include:

  • Commercial License


  • Professional/Service License


  • Industrial License


  • E-commerce License


  • Media License



Your license officially allows you to start operations.

Step 8: Open a Corporate Bank Account


Dubai provides access to world-class banks such as:

  • Emirates NBD


  • ADIB


  • FAB


  • Mashreq


  • RAKBANK



Free zones also assist in bank account opening support.

Step 9: Apply for Visas


As a business owner, you can apply for:

  • Investor visa


  • Partner visa


  • Employee visas


  • Family visas



Dubai's visa process is digital, fast, and straightforward.

Cost of Setting Up a Business in Dubai


Costs vary depending on:

  • Mainland vs Free Zone


  • Type of license


  • Office space


  • Number of visas



Average business setup costs:

  • Free Zone: AED 6,000 to AED 25,000+


  • Mainland: AED 15,000 to AED 30,000+
